Synopsis

Plenty of people want to write poetry - yet while it is not difficult to write poetry badly, it is harder to write it well. In this guide Fred Sedgwick explains, with numerous examples from successful poets, how the creative process works, from the initial impulse to write all the way through to crafted and expressive poetry at the end.

Author Bio
Fred Sedgwick is mainstream poet who has published two collections as well as many poems in serials such as the Times Literary Supplement (TLS). Times Educational Supplement (TES) and Quarto. His poetry has appeared in over 40 collections. He has written books about writing, literature and the expressive arts for Continuum, Routledge and Falmer, David Fulton, and Bloomsbury.
